WebSubcutaneous Skin Layer. The subcutaneous layer of the skin is the deepest of the three layers, found below the epidermis and the dermis. It is not considered a true skin layer but it contains many structures that support the functions of the skin in the other layers. WebThe subcutaneous layer under the dermis is made up of connective tissue and fat (a good insulator). Functions of the skin. Provides a protective barrier against mechanical, thermal and physical injury and hazardous substances. Prevents loss of moisture. Reduces harmful effects of UV radiation. WebThe dermis or corium is a layer of skin between the epidermis (with which it makes up the cutis) and subcutaneous tissues, that primarily consists of dense irregular connective tissue and cushions the body from stress and strain. It is divided into two layers, the superficial area adjacent to the epidermis called the papillary region and a deep thicker area known …

WebMar 9, 2024 · The hypodermis is the bottom layer of skin. Also known as subcutaneous tissue, the hypodermis insulates and protects the body, stores energy (fat), helps to regulate body temperature, and connects the skin to muscles and bones. 1. The hypodermis is one of the three layers of human skin, the others being the epidermis (outer layer) and dermis ...
